RANCANG BANGUN PERAGA PRAKTIKUM KONTROL LEVEL AIR PADA TANDON DAN BAK MENGGUNAKAN PLC

Penelitian yang dilakukan adalah rancang bangun alat peraga praktikum berupa modul kontrol level air pada tandon dan bak. Output berupa pompa air dan solenoid valve. Pompa digunakan untuk mengalirkan air dari sumur ke tandon sedangkan solenoid valve digunakan untuk mengalirkan air dari tandon ke bak. Kerja pompa di pengaruhi level air di sumur dan tandon, kondisi awal sumur penuh (sensor level air sumur on) dan tandon kosong (sensor level atas dan bawah tandon off). Pada kondisi ini pompa bekerja beberapa saat kemudian sensor level bawah tandon on dan pompa masih bekerja. Pompa berhenti bekerja saat sensor level atas tandon berubah menjadi on (tandon penuh). Apabila tandon kembali kosong maka pompa akan kembali bekerja. Jika suatu saat sumur kering (sensor level air sumur off) maka pompa tidak akan bekerja, pompa akan bekerja kembali jika sumur kembali penuh. Kerja selenoid valve hanya dipengaruhi kondisi level air di bak saja. Saat bak kosong (Sensor level air bak off), selenoid valve (SV) akan bekerja. Ketika bak penuh (sensor level air bak on) selenoid valve (SV) akan berhenti bekerja. Sensor level air disumur dan bak digunakan mercury switch yang dimasukkan pelampung, untuk sensor level air tendon digunakan proximity capasitive.Downloads
